This trailblazing purveyor of quality coffee has held firm to its aim to nurture fair relationships with its worldwide suppliers since it opened more than 30 years ago. From a sweet, full-bodied Brazilian coffee to a spicy Indonesian blend, Monmouth’s beans are catnip to caffeine lovers. The beans are roasted and sold in-store; there’s also space to sit down and savour a cup alongside a tasty pastisserie, sourced from nearby bakery Paul and Villandry, or perhaps a wintery fresh-cream truffle made by local chocolatier Sally Clarke.
